GreenTech North America expands conference program with leading CEA experts

The two-day Conference of GreenTech North America is taking shape as preparations for the Expo are in full swing. The event will take place on Wednesday, September 23 and Thursday, September 24 at the Pennsylvania Convention Center in Philadelphia.

The conference focuses on innovations and developments shaping horticulture across North America and covers all major crop types, from vegetables and soft fruit crops to ornamentals and medicinal plants. The program will bring together industry leaders, growers, researchers and policymakers to share insights through high-level knowledge sessions on Controlled Environment Agriculture (CEA). Key topics include energy, human capital, digital growing, artificial intelligence, and strategies to address rising operational costs. In addition, the conference will facilitate an important dialogue between industry stakeholders and government representatives.

Conference program GreenTech North America

Opening: 
On Wednesday, September 23, the show kicks off with the official opening ceremony from 09:00 AM to 10:00 AM, led by Mariska Dreschler (Director Horticulture, GreenTech Global). Additional keynote speakers will be announced shortly, including representatives from political and governmental organizations. Adding a touch of history to the opening program, a renowned Benjamin Franklin impersonator will bring Philadelphia’s most famous Founding Father to life. Through humor, storytelling, and audience interaction, this engaging performance will celebrate Franklin’s contributions to agriculture, honor Philadelphia’s rich heritage, and commemorate the 250th anniversary of the United States. 
A selection of the Conference knowledge sessions: 

Day 1:  

  • Wednesday, September 23, 11:40 AM – 12:30 PM: ‘Beyond the Leaf: Building Profitable Growth in the Hydro Leafy Greens Sector’ by Serdar Mizrakci (Element Farms), Don Courtemanche (Grodan) and moderated by Sonny Moerenhout (Cultivators) 
  • Wednesday, September 23, 12:40 PM – 1:30 PM: ‘Growing the CEA Greenhouse Ecosystem in North America: Advancing Technology, Scaling Operations, and Building Talent’ by Peter Ravensbergen (Wageningen University & Research), Qinglu Ying (University of Kentucky), Chieri Kubota (Ohio State University), Qingwu Meng (University of Delaware) and moderated by Chris Higgins (Hort Americas)  

Day 2: 

  • Thursday, September 24, 10:40 AM – 11:30 AM: ‘Vertical farming: How to stay ahead in a fast-changing industry’ by Tisha Livingston (Infinite Acres), Hiroki Koga (Oishii) and moderated by Ryan Douglas (Ryan Douglas Cultivation) 
  • Thursday, September 24, 10:40 AM – 11:30 AM: ‘The Cost & ROI of AI in CEA: Where Does It Actually Add Value?’ by Tomas Geurts (Source) and Henry Gordon-Smith (Agritecture) 
  • Thursday, September 24, 11:40 AM – 12:30 PM: ‘Aligning Policy, Capital, and Operations in CEA’ by Henry Gordon-Smith (Agritecture), Michael Roth (Commonwealth) and Bob Gunn (Seinergy)  

Plant Empowerment Workshop

On Tuesday, September 22, GreenTech North America will host a Plant Empowerment Workshop for growers and horticultural professionals. The one-day program, 8:30 AM – 5:00 PM, will offer practical insights into Plant Empowerment principles, water management, crop optimisation, and climate control strategies, led by experts Evripidis Papadopoulos (Hoogendoorn), René Beerkens (Hoogendoorn), Ruud Schulte (Van der Ende Group), Ton Habraken (Svensson), Amos Bassi (Philips Horticulture LED Solutions) and Paul van Gils (Lumiforte). More information and registration here
